Chapter 661: Dragon Eggs! Here I Come!!!!!

Compared to the Sacrifice Faction, the Redemption Faction was much simpler and more direct.

Typically, it involved the Arm of Saint, which resided in the left hand of the practitioner, and could purify and redeem the souls of humans warped by desire and animals corrupted by demonic energy, restoring them to their original state.

If they were human, they would be brought back to the outpost; if they were monsters, they would be released back into the wild.

In their view, it was these desires and demonic energies that caused ecological imbalance. Creatures cleansed of these things naturally deserved to return to their ecological niche... However, certain events recently had severely slapped the Redemption Faction in the face.

The Arm of Saint could indeed purify the warped desires on humanoid monsters, restoring them to their original state, but it could not change the fundamental nature of a person.

These purified individuals merely reverted from 100% corruption to 1% corruption, and the essence that triggered their corruption was the desire buried deep within their hearts.

How could a person possibly be completely cleansed of desire? The seven emotions and six desires would, at most, have highs and lows; without desire, one would not be human, or even a living creature.

Therefore, their re-transformation into monsters was only a matter of time.

Those unable to uphold their true selves, allowing desire to exploit their weaknesses, would inevitably undergo transformation in the New World.

In fact, similar incidents had already occurred, and in no small number. Even the Great Commander, who originally advocated for Redemption and used this power, showed slight traces of demonization, indicating he had made a choice that went against his original intention under extreme circumstances.

Redemption and Sacrifice, one repeatedly prolonging death, the other a decisive death sentence, both were difficult choices for both the dead and the living... But what did that have to do with me!?

After listening to the heartfelt narratives from both sides, Cheng Tian, who was pouring mushroom soup into his mouth, didn't even twitch an eyebrow.

The Monster Hunter world, integrated with the Soul Sacrifice system, indeed gained a tragic atmosphere reminiscent of dark Gothic style. But from Cheng Tian's perspective, these NPCs, caught up in the Redemption and Sacrifice systems, simply lacked sufficient power.

In their view, Cheng Tian, having already set foot on the New World and similarly compelled to acquire the Redemption and Sacrifice power system, would inevitably face the same problems. Rather than being helpless when the time came, at least their experience could give Cheng Tian some courage to make choices.

However, they had no idea that Cheng's abilities in this regard far exceeded their imagination.

Cheng Tian, who swallowed the last bite of mushroom, clapped his hands and stood up from the stone stool, then stretched out his arms under the gaze of those around him.

On his right arm, the Ogre Gauntlet appeared. The protruding Ogre Eye in the middle section of the bracer, which could absorb and imprison souls, looked even more agile and eerie than Merlin's Arm of Demon.

On his left arm, a deep red heart materialized. This was the gratitude expressed by the souls of the innocents 'saved' by Cheng Tian.

Both the Great Commander and Merlin sprang up from their stone stools, looking at Cheng Tian's hands with incredulity.

The power of Redemption and the power of Sacrifice coexisted on Cheng Tian's arms, not interfering with each other, and arguably even advancing side by side.

The powers of Redemption and Sacrifice should ideally cancel each other out, with the strength of one inevitably leading to the weakening of the other. But this phenomenon was not seen in Cheng Tian.

Saint and Demon! Coexistence!

This was a man who could both become a saint and a demon!

"You wouldn't mind if I established a Balance Faction here, would you?"

As soon as Cheng Tian finished speaking, such a spatial prompt popped up before his eyes.

You have triggered a special side quest — "Please Call Me Grandmaster."

Team Quest: As the leader of the Blazing Sun Legion, in the "Monster Hunter + Soul Sacrifice" instance, you have successfully demonstrated a third possibility—Balance—between the two opposing factions of Redemption and Sacrifice;

You need to attempt to develop at least 1 faction member, eliminating the severe side effects brought by "Redemption and Sacrifice" for them, to demonstrate the feasibility of the Balance Faction's development to the Starcatcher Outpost and the upper echelons of the Hunter's Guild.

Upon successful demonstration, Balance Faction members in this instance will be considered Blazing Sun Legion members. At the same time, your "Mobile Fortress" will gain 1 permission to descend into the current instance.

...As mentioned before, when a player's strength reaches a certain scale and level, their very existence will have a series of influences, or even "pollution," on the instance.

And there were simply too many points on Cheng Tian that could affect the current instance.

This included, but was not limited to, the "Monster Knight" brought by the template, the "Black Pearl Holy Grail" which was still in the hands of the twin goddesses but could already be used relatively freely, the extra skill "Soul Rescue," the extra equipment "Ogre Gauntlet," and even Cheng Tian's strawberry boxer shorts might reveal some trickery.

Originally, Cheng Tian needed to adapt to the instance, but now there would be some reversal; situations where the instance had to adapt to Cheng Tian would probably start to become more frequent.

Being able to host both saintly and demonic powers within his body without affecting his soul, and without causing physical transformation, was undoubtedly a thunderous special event for the Starcatcher Outpost, which had already been thoroughly marinated in the Soul Sacrifice system.

If they could figure out how Cheng Tian achieved this, then the hunter mages who had been temporarily released from their demonized state under the protection of the Redemption Faction, but still had the potential for demonization and were therefore being treated differently, would be saved.

At the same time, those suffering from the torment of their companions' souls could also find liberation.

However, it's easier said than done. Cheng Tian obtained two extra skill items through template buffs and main quest settlements, and the Heart Priest was an S-rank profession obtained with great effort. Perhaps it was under the blessing of these things that he was able to circumvent the cost of Redemption and Sacrifice.

But the quest still had to be done, or rather, a way had to be found to complete it.

If the Martian mothership could be summoned, that Zorah Magdaros, which was theoretically impossible to hunt, might even be captured. Who knows, he might even unearth the legendary Zorah Magdaros egg?

Cheng Tian, glancing at his Kulu-Ya-Ku MAX skill, also felt a surge of excitement in his heart.

So, how exactly should he prove the feasibility of his Balance Faction?

With this question, Cheng Tian's gaze began to scan the panel covered with various small side quests. After casually accepting a quest to "investigate Elder Dragon tracks," he immediately led his people into what was called the Ancient Forest.

Cheng Tian's mental scan instantly spread out, covering a large area. In his perception, besides hunters scattered in different areas, there were also numerous round objects that were similarly marked—

Without exception! All of them were dragon eggs!
